Re: HHA Optimizer
I'm not an HHA fan. However, for those that want to add one, you will need an 'old' style mount vs a 'new' style. On the 'old' one, the dovetail runs the whole length of the mount. The 'new' ones are relieved of the last bit of the dovetail to fit scopes w/ larger housings.
